Output e8c686586161c7dd111f952b757425fef760fed990f59f8093567c95f0502b06:23

value
21374
script pubkey
OP_0 OP_PUSHBYTES_20 672d1dbfe3c9036d362225311feb8f2a68fbeb2b
address
bc1qvuk3m0lreypk6d3zy5c3l6u09f50h6et2nlqm9
transaction
e8c686586161c7dd111f952b757425fef760fed990f59f8093567c95f0502b06
spent
true